  • Abstract
    Automatic Meter Reading (AMR) smart grid system is determining the needs of all the vital aspects e.g. daily workflow, workforce management, asset management, call center philosophy, billing systematic etc. AMR system could cover variety of installation techniques meeting customer requirements. The concepts presented include installation of standalone automated metering system which only enable monitoring of load on transformers, automated reading with full controlling features using SCADA system where as metering management system operating separately. Moreover, it also includes automated meter reading with limited controlling and enhanced function of SCADA system. More advanced features of an integrated AMR, enhanced distribution management system with full controlling, monitoring and Geographic Information System (GIS) are also addressed. AMR smart grid system provides fundamental benefits including efficient power system control and monitoring, Timely operational decisions to minimize outages and losses and acquiring meter readings of several energy interchange points and many 11 KV incoming and outgoing feeders.
